In this Age of Emerging Technologies the idea of Wireless Power Transfer and the use of autonomous drones for various applications has come into the spotlight. This paper proposes the idea of Wireless Power Transfer for charging the batteries of electric powered Unmanned Aerial Vehicles(UAV).The proposed wireless charging system for drones have been performed by considering Aurelia X6 Pro and it operates at a high frequency of 85 KHZ with the air gap of 100 mm separating the Transmitter coil(Placed at the charging station) and the receiver coil(Placed inside the drone to enable wireless charging).This paper presents the concepts of coil design and coil tuning to design a better charging system for UAVS. This has been achieved using Ansys Maxwell Software for design of various coils and Lt spice for tuning the circuit. The WPT system proposed is achieved using Magnetic resonant coupling with two coil WPT system using Series-Series Topology (SS Topology).
